Pulling out of FIFA is FA's nuclear option

Evening Standard

John Whittingdale accepts that England could be seen as bad losers. We are discussing today's report by the Select Committee for Culture, Media and Sport on the failed 2018 World Cup bid, which says it is "appalling" how FIFA have swept aside "allegations of corruption" against members of its executive. To make matters worse, say the MPs, FIFA are treating those making the allegations with "contempt".

"There is a danger that, having got a derisory two votes, one of them English, we will be accused of sour grapes," says Whittingdale, chairman of the committee. "But it is not. The evidence of corruption is overwhelming.
